My int is 107 and I have 43 str, lvl 22.
Hmm, yeah, hybrid INTs are somewhat better at pvping if compared to pure INTs because of their higher survivability. As you are a pure INT (you have 1 STR point added btw), I'd assume you are looking for high damage? Then I'd suggest you a hybrid with 10 lvls of STR (so 30 points of STR), at 100 cap that'd mean you are a 1:9 hybrid int. You can add these 10 lvls of STR whenever you feel like, though I'd suggest it to be near cap (~ lvl 70+). There are plenty other ways of building hybrids, just know that the more STR you have, the higher your survivability will be but the lower your damage will be. You can choose something different from what I've suggested if you want more survivability or something different, feel free to try anything, but it'd be better to ask first.

I don't know what the 5 means. And I thought that 2 : 3 means you put 2 str and 3 int when you can. :s
It's math. A 2:3 ratio means 2 str points to 3 int points, which means exaclty the same as 1:1,5, 1 STR point to 1,5 INT point, the latter one is just simplified. I don't really know how to explain math in english though. That 5 is from 1,5, it's one and a half.
A rather easy way to use these ratios is, at 90 cap you'll have leveled 89 times (from lvl 1 to 90) so at level 90 you'd have spent 267 status points:
Spoiler!
STR points = x INT points = y Using a 2:1 hybrid int as example, y = 2x (2 INT points to 1 STR point)
Now, as at lvl 90 you'd have 267 status points, x+y=267 Points spent into INT + Points spent into STR = 267
as y = 2x; and x+y=267: x+2x=267 x=267/3 x=89 Which means you'll have added 89 STR points at lvl 90. And as y = 2x; y = 2(89); y = 178, so 178 INT points at lvl 90.
Now, there are basically two ways of getting this ratio, one of them is to calcualte it at a caculater such as bobtheveg or the ones at nivlam, I personally prefer this one: http://bobtheveg.dyndns.org/sroprofile/
Then after spending the status points there accordingly, memorize the physical and the magical balance and everytime you level throughout the game take off all your equipment which has INT or STR blues, so to get your "naked" balances and level your stats accordingly so to get as near as possible or exactly to the balances you got at bobtheveg.
An other way, which is easier with some ratios and harder for others, is to each time you level add a certain quantity of points, such as in this case, a 2:1 hybrid int, knowing that you get 3 status points each level up, all you have to do is add 2 of those into INT and 1 into STR.
Also, it's possible, to with a build which has a ratio of like 1:9 at 100 cap, which means you'd add 30 points into STR, which then means exactly 10 lvls of STR (each level you get 3 status points; 30/3=10), and you can add these 10 lvls whenever you feel like, like from levels 70 to 80; or from levels 75 to 80 and later from 85 to 90. Just wondering though, would 100 fire/100heuk/100ice be better than 100lighting/100heuk/100ice.
Neither one is better.
Fire offers a wide variety of nukes and they have bigger range and are somewhat more effective than lightning's counterpart (note that lightning offers basically one maxed nuke at 100 cap, fire offers three). Fire also offers magical defense, fire wall, immunity and destealth/deinvisible.
Lightning offers basically speed and mobility, which are invaluable in group situations (mainly ghost walk, as you can buy speed pots).
Therefore, and in a very general manner of speaking, fire is better at 1vs1 pvping, lightning is better at grinding and group pvping. Make your choice.
